Non-polypoid colorectal neoplasms are relatively common worldwide
Ana Ignjatovic1, Brian P Saunders
1Wolfson Unit for Endoscopy, Imperial College, St Mark's Hospital, Watford Road, Harrow, HA1 3UJ, London, UK.
Flat adenomas are common, but flat colorectal cancers are rare (5-10% of colonoscopies). Flat lesions with depression pose a significant malignancy risk, potentially preceding small, flat cancers.

Background:
- Flat adenomas are frequently detected during colonoscopies globally.
- Small, flat, submucosally invasive colorectal cancers are uncommon, representing 5-10% of cancers found during colonoscopy.
- Defining flat lesions consistently is challenging, leading to study variations.
Purpose of the Study:
- To investigate the characteristics and malignant potential of flat colorectal neoplasms.
- To differentiate between flat elevated lesions and flat lesions with depression.
- To clarify the role of flat lesions as precursors to colorectal cancer.
Main Methods:
- Review of existing literature on flat colorectal neoplasms.
- Analysis of colonoscopy findings and pathological reports.
- Comparison of flat lesion definitions and their impact on reported frequencies.
Main Results:
- Flat elevated lesions are common and have a low risk of malignancy.
- Flat lesions with depression are associated with a significant risk of malignancy.
- These depressed flat lesions may be precursors to small, flat, or ulcerating cancers.
Conclusions:
- Flat lesions with depression represent a high-risk group for colorectal cancer development.
- Standardized definitions are needed for accurate assessment of flat colorectal neoplasms.
- Early identification and management of depressed flat lesions are crucial for cancer prevention.
